1ST QUARTER REVENUE MONITORING REPORT 2018/2019 - GENERAL FUND AND HOUSING REVENUE ACCOUNT

Decision Maker: Executive

Decision status: For Determination

Is Key decision?: Yes

Is subject to call in?: No

Decision:

The Executive considered a report that provided an update on the General Fund and Housing Revenue Account (HRA) projected 2018/19 outturn, including any carry forward requests, updates on savings and growth bids.

 

In relation to the peppercorn rent issue referred to in Paragraph 4.2.8 of the report, the Leader requested that officers take steps to negotiate the full increase from peppercorn to higher rent levels with Registered Social Providers.

 

It was RESOLVED:

 

General Fund

 

1.         That the 1st Quarter projected net increase in General Fund expenditure of £195,750 is approved.

 

2.         That it be noted that cumulative changes made to the General Fund net budget remains within the £400,000 increase variation limit delegated to the Executive.

 

3.         That the progress of the 2018/19 approved Financial Security options, growth bids and carry forward requests is noted.

 

4.         That it be noted that the 2019/20 ongoing net pressure of £57,090 will be incorporated into the General Fund Medium Term Financial Strategy (MTFS).

 

Housing Revenue Account (HRA)

 

1.         That the 2018/19 1st Quarter projected net increase in HRA net deficit of £75,400 be approved.

 

2.         That it be noted that the cumulative increases made to the HRA net budget remains within the £250,000 increase variation limit delegated to the Executive.

 

3.         That the progress of the 2018/19 approved Financial Security options, growth bids and carry forward requests is noted

 

4.         That budget carry forwards to 2019/2020 of £60,000 are approved.
